Ten cases recorded so far this year
The number of suicides verdicts on the Island this year is already double the figure for 2017.
There have been 10 cases recorded by the coroner, as of the end of August, compared to 5 in the whole of 2017.
It's the highest figure since 2012.
However, the figures haven't shown a steady increase over recent years.
Just one case was recorded in 2014 - the following year this had risen to 8, but dropped again to 3 in 2016.
